How Common Is The Last Name Mornes? popularity and diffusion
Mornes is the 1,649,806th most commonly used surname on a global scale It is held by around 1 in 60,227,652 people. This last name is primarily found in The Americas, where 99 percent of Mornes are found; 95 percent are found in North America and 95 percent are found in Anglo-North America. Mornes is also the 3,487,849th most frequent forename throughout the world. It is borne by 11 people.
The surname Mornes is most common in The United States, where it is carried by 114 people, or 1 in 3,179,464. In The United States it is primarily found in: Texas, where 58 percent live, Minnesota, where 14 percent live and California, where 11 percent live. Outside of The United States this last name is found in 5 countries. It also occurs in Brazil, where 2 percent live and Colombia, where 2 percent live.
Mornes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Mornes has changed over time. In The United States the number of people bearing the Mornes last name increased 1,036 percent between 1880 and 2014.
